淘先锋技术网

首页 1 2 3 4 5 6 7

Java是一种非常流行的编程语言,用来实现各种不同的功能。其中,求n和m阶乘就是其中之一。下面我们来看一下如何使用Java来实现。

public class Factorial {
public static int factorial(int n) {
if (n == 0) {
return 1;
} else {
return n * factorial(n-1);
}
}
public static void main(String[] args) {
int n = 5;
int m = 10;
int nFactorial = factorial(n);
int mFactorial = factorial(m);
System.out.println(n + "的阶乘是:" + nFactorial);
System.out.println(m + "的阶乘是:" + mFactorial);
}
}

在上面的代码中,我们定义了一个Factorial类,其中包含一个factorial方法和一个main方法。factorial方法用来计算一个数的阶乘,而main方法则用来调用factorial方法,并输出结果。

在main方法中,我们使用了两个变量n和m,分别为5和10。然后,我们调用了factorial方法来计算它们的阶乘,并将结果存储在nFactorial和mFactorial变量中。最后,我们使用System.out.println方法来输出结果。

总的来说,使用Java来求n和m阶乘非常简单。只需要定义一个方法来计算阶乘,然后在main方法中调用它即可。希望这篇文章对大家有所帮助!